Paper white narcissus do not need cold treating so I started a bagful of those earlier this month to be ready by Christmas. They were cheap at Home Depot and I have several containers going. One trick I learned on this site last year: after the stalks are 5-6 inches tall, drain and change out water with vodka/water solution (7 parts water, 1 part alcohol if using 80 proof cheap vodka). Water with alcohol/water solution and stalks will be markedly shorter, no flopping over, and blooms are just as nice.
